Medical Malpractice
Birth injuries can have devastating effects that last a lifetime. A successful lawsuit could help parents gain justice and recover compensation for the future care of their child in the event that a medical mistake caused the injury.
The first step in pursuing the medical malpractice claim is to find a skilled lawyer. An experienced birth trauma lawyer will work with medical experts and examine documents to find any possible malpractice. They will also discuss the matter with you in depth and answer any questions you may have.
Medical negligence lawsuits can be complicated and require difficult witnesses. Teams of lawyers are on the side of hospitals, doctors and insurance companies who are trained to reduce or eliminate payments. It is crucial to locate an attorney who is able to combat these powerful opponents.
A medical malpractice claim has four parts: duty, breach, causation, and damages. An experienced birth injury lawyer will work with you to gather evidence and birth injury law firm develop strong legal arguments to support each of these elements.
In the case of a birth injury, the duty element is to establish that you had a professional relationship between your doctor and you. This could be accomplished through medical documents or hospital bills. The next step is to establish that the doctor has the duty to perform his duties with reasonable skill and care that would be expected from a medical professional in the same situation.
Birth Injury
An attorney for birth injuries could assist a family with filing an action for medical malpractice against the doctor or hospital that acted in negligence during labor and birth. A successful legal case could result in financial compensation that can help families pay for their child's future and current medical expenses, lost wages, and emotional trauma.
A experienced birth injury lawyer will know how to look over your child's medical records and determine any potential instances of negligence and hire experts (often other OB/GYN doctors) to review the case and give their opinion regarding whether there was malpractice. After the experts have analyzed the case, your lawyer can determine who is responsible for the injuries. They will then name the defendants.
In New York and most other states, there is a statute of limitations which sets the deadline for filing a claim. For birth injury claims, it is usually 30 months or two and two and a half (2-1/2) years following the time that the medical malpractice occurred.
During this time during this time, your attorney will negotiate a settlement with your insurance company on behalf of you. Your attorney will file a lawsuit in the appropriate court if the insurance company refuses to pay a reasonable amount. A jury and judge will then make a decision. This is a lengthy procedure that should be handled by a professional.
